Methods and apparatus for automatically configuring an aggregated link between a device supporting Fibre Channel over Ethernet (FCoE) and two or more FCoE Forwarders (FCFs) configured as a virtual switch in an effort to isolate FCoE traffic from FCoE Initialization Protocol (FIP) traffic in the aggregated link without user intervention. The virtual switch may be configured using virtual PortChannel (vPC) or MultiChassis EtherChannel (MCEC) technology, for example. For some embodiments, following an exchange of Data Center Bridge Exchange (DCBX) Protocol packets identifying the aggregated link relationship to the device (e.g., a host or intermediate bridge), subchannels may be automatically created within the aggregated link and designated as carrying either FCoE or FIP traffic, thereby isolating the subchannels. In this manner, a user need not perform manual isolation of FCoE-carrying trunks in a data center environment.
